笔记:逻辑与运算
dengruixun · · 个人记录
逻辑与运算
码:
真值:
指十进制转二进制整数,
原码:
原码 = 符号 + 真值
反码:
正数 = 原码 负数 = 符号 + 真值取反
补码:
正数 = 原码 负数 = 反码 + 1
逻辑:
逻辑符号:
名 称:非 与 或 异或
逻辑符号:! && || ^
数学符号:﹁ Λ ﹀ ?
等级:() > ! > && > ||
符号意义与用法:
- 非:取反。
- 与:全部成立才成立。
- 或:一项成立则成立。
- 异或:不同则成立。
按位:
按位符号:
名 称:反 与 或 异或
逻辑符号:~ & | ^
符号意义与用法:
按位用二进制补码。
- 反:符号及所有数位逐位取反。
- 与:补码个位对齐,逐位比较,都是
1 成立。 - 或:补码个位对齐,逐位比较,只要有
1 成立。 - 异或:补码个位对齐,逐位比较,不同成立。